Below are the top six must-attend construction events for 2018, in chronological order.

1. RICS Summit Series 2018

rics

May 14, 2018—New York City, New York

Each year, the RICS Summit Series offers several opportunities for construction professionals to attend a one-day summit in a major city in the U.S., Canada, and Mexico.

For 2018, the summit series will come to Miami (on March 20) and New York (May 14,), offering the chance to network with industry leaders and design innovators in the construction business.

The summit is jam packed with education on key topics impacting the construction industry, including the role of cities, the influence of technology and digital transformation, resilience, and sustainability in building, infrastructure, and ethics.

2. CONSTRUCT Show

construct

October 3-5, 2018—Long Beach, California

The CONSTRUCT Show in Long Beach, Calif. will focus on educating commercial building teams using real-world, practical knowledge. You'll be able to learn about the latest trends in the industry, as well as business operations management, career path success, and efficiency in construction business financials. This conference is a particularly good place to network with architects, designers, engineers, and project managers. The conference's exhibit hall also has a wide array of construction companies, whether there's a product you're looking for or just want to find out who the players are in your sector.

3. CMAA National Conference and Trade Show

CMAA

October 14-16, 2018—Las Vegas, Nevada

There's always a lot of reasons to take the time to visit Las Vegas, but October of this year presents the perfect opportunity for construction professionals to make it a business-focused trip. The Construction Management Association of America's National Conference and Trade Show is one of the leading industry gatherings meant to inform construction managers, finance professionals, and building personnel on the trends impacting today's construction businesses.

The conference packs in educational workshops and breakout sessions designed to provide helpful information on surety bond pricing for construction professionals, technology innovations for business management, and financial accounting standards best practices for finance managers.

Throughout the three-day event, construction professionals can network with other industry leaders, owners, and project managers while learning about what's ahead for the construction marketplace.

4. Design-Build Institute of America Conference and Expo

dbia

November 7-9, 2018—New Orleans, Louisiana

This year's Design-Build Conference and Expo, presented by the Design-Build Institute, brings together national construction owners and design-builders to discuss industry trends and market movements for the upcoming year.

The conference and expo also provide several educational workshops, keynote speakers, and panel discussions to help inform industry professionals who specifically want to learn about the design-build arena. Attendees also have the option to earn up to 12 hours of CEUs throughout the three-day event.

5. Groundbreak 2018

groundbreak

November 13-15, 2018—Austin, Texas

Procore's Groundbreak conference is a great place to hear about top-level, big ideas affecting the construction industry, from utilizing artificial intelligence to crunching data from your construction site.

You may even get to see a celebrity—last year's conference featured Mike Rowe from "Dirty Jobs."

The conference attracts more than 3,000 attendees from all parts of the industry, providing tons of opportunities for networking and problem-solving.

6. Greenbuild International Conference and Expo

greenbuild

November 14-16, 2018—Chicago, Illinois

Chicago is the place to be in November if you're a construction professional and can't make Groundbreak 2018—especially if you're really curious about the hot topic of green construction.

During this year's conference, Greenbuild partners will share the stage to discuss what's happening in design and construction. The conference focuses on technology, design and building trends, and new ideas in construction that lead to the most sustainable green construction around the world. Through educational programs, keynote speakers, and exhibition hall vendors, attendees have an opportunity to learn how their business can turn green in the upcoming year.
